These videos about Daily Painting are interesting. I personally use this journey as a learning experience. You hit the nail on the head by stating that the more you do the better you become. Many people (outside of artists) think you are born an artist when in fact, it's a lot of work setting challenges and practicing to achieve self imposed milestones. Look at any "daily painters" blog and you will see marked improvement over time. It's amazing.
It is my experience after nearly 600 days that doing this EVERY SINGLE DAY nearly no matter what, makes things happen artistically. What happens is that you pull out things that you did not even know was there simply because you paint in all kinds of emotional states and life situations.
